Title :
Optimal dispersion management schemes for WDM soliton systems

Abstract :
Optimal dispersion profiles for a WDM soliton system are obtained by minimising the radiative noise and the collision-induced frequency shift. A two-step optimal profile without dispersion slaving to the ideal exponential profile allows a large increase in the amplifier spacing with no significant deterioration of the system performance
